Sofrito is a fundamental component of Puerto Rican cuisine, known for its vibrant flavor and versatility. When I first tried making homemade sofrito, I was surprised by how fresh and aromatic it smells compared to store-bought versions. The key ingredients usually include a blend of garlic, onions, peppers, cilantro, and culantro, all finely chopped or blended to create a flavorful base for many traditional dishes. One tip I learned is to prepare larger batches and freeze them in small portions using ice cube trays or small containers. This way, you always have fresh sofrito ready to add to soups, stews, rice, or beans without extra effort each time. It's essential to use fresh, high-quality ingredients, as they greatly influence the final taste. Also, don't hesitate to adjust the quantities of peppers or herbs to suit your personal preference. Making homemade sofrito allows you to control salt and spice levels, making it a healthier option than many pre-packaged products.
